with some light weekend kernel hacking, i was able to port OpenBSD's driver for Apple Silicon SPI keyboard/trackpad to Intel and get it working on my 2015 12" MacBook, making OpenBSD the first alternative OS i've been able to get the trifecta of ssd/keyboard/wifi working in (linux has drivers for everything but they don't work, freebsd has the keyboard driver, but no wifi, and nvme needs hacking)
